    the VCR (either VHS or S-VHS). When S-VHS tapes are played in the SLV-N700, the enhanced resolution will not be visible on screen; there may also be picture distortion while playing the S-VHS tape in slow motion or while utilizing other special playback modes. The SLV-N700 will not record in S-VHS

    Monaural sound on the normal audio track On-screen display HI-FI LEFT RIGHT MONO Display window Hi-Fi Hi-Fi Hi-Fi No indicator How sound is recorded on a video tape The VCR records sound onto two separate tracks. Hi-fi audio is recorded onto the main track along with the picture. Monaural sound
